Monthly Airbnb Revenue Variations & Income Potential in Porsanger (2025)
Understanding the monthly revenue variations for Airbnb listings in Porsanger is key to maximizing your short term rental income potential. Seasonality significantly impacts earnings. Our analysis, based on data from the past 12 months, shows that the peak revenue month for STRs in Porsanger is typically October, while November often presents the lowest earnings, highlighting opportunities for strategic pricing adjustments during shoulder and low seasons. Explore the typical Airbnb income in Porsanger across different performance tiers: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ve $4,021+ monthly, often utilizing dynamic pricing and superior guest experiences.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) earn $2,775 or more, indicating effective management and desirable locations/amenities.
- Typical properties (Median) generate around $1,656 per month, representing the average market performance.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) see earnings around $829, often with potential for optimization.

Average Daily Rate (ADR) Airbnb Trends in Porsanger (2025)
Effective short term rental pricing strategy in Porsanger involves understanding monthly ADR fluctuations. The Average Daily Rate (ADR) for Airbnb in Porsanger typically peaks in July and dips lowest during March. Leveraging Airbnb dynamic pricing tools or strategies based on this seasonality can significantly boost revenue. Here's a look at the typical nightly rates achieved: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) command rates of $210+ per night, often due to premium features or locations.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) achieve nightly rates of $174 or more.
- Typical properties (Median) charge around $122 per night.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) earn around $84 per night.

Airbnb Seasonality Analysis & Trends in Porsanger (2025)
Peak Season (October, July, December)
- Revenue averages $2,413 per month
- Occupancy rates average 47.2%
- Daily rates average $138
Shoulder Season
- Revenue averages $1,861 per month
- Occupancy maintains around 41.3%
- Daily rates hold near $137
Low Season (March, June, November)
- Revenue drops to average $1,489 per month
- Occupancy decreases to average 31.6%
- Daily rates adjust to average $135
Seasonality Insights for Porsanger
- The Airbnb seasonality in Porsanger shows moderate seasonality with distinct peak and low periods.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it's also insightful to look at the extremes:
- During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Porsanger's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ues capable of climbing to $2,723, occupancy reaching a high of 51.6%, and ADRs peaking at $162.
- Conversely, the slowest single month of the year, typically falling within the low season, marks the market's lowest point. In this month, revenue might dip to $1,467, occupancy could drop to 27.8%, and ADRs may adjust down to $121.

Porsanger ST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)
Average Booking Lead Time by Month
Booking Lead Time Insights for Porsanger
- The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Porsanger is 59 days.
- Guests book furthest in advance for stays during November (average 79 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
- The shortest booking windows occur for stays in May (average 24 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
- Seasonally, Fall (70 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Spring (43 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.

Porsanger Airbnb Guest Demographics & Profile Analysis (2025)
Guest Profile Summary for Porsanger
- The typical guest profile for Airbnb in Porsanger consists of predominantly international visitors (87%), with top international origins including Germany, typically belonging to the Post-2000s (Gen Z/Alpha) group (50%), primarily speaking English or German.
- Domestic travelers account for 13.3% of guests.
- Key international markets include Finland (20.3%) and Germany (18.9%).
- Top languages spoken are English (40.1%) followed by German (13.5%).
- A significant demographic segment is the Post-2000s (Gen Z/Alpha) group, representing 50% of guests.
